#include "QXmppClient.h"
#include "QXmppVCardIq.h"
#include "QXmppVCardManager.h"
#include <memory>
#include "IntegrationTesting.h"
#include "util.h"
#include <QObject>
Q_DECLARE_METATYPE(QXmppVCardIq);
class tst_QXmppVCardManager : public QObject
{
Q_OBJECT
private:
Q_SLOT void testHandleStanza_data();
Q_SLOT void testHandleStanza();
// integration tests
Q_SLOT void testSetClientVCard();
QXmppClient m_client;
};
void tst_QXmppVCardManager::testHandleStanza_data()
{
QTest::addColumn<QXmppVCardIq>("expectedIq");
QTest::addColumn<bool>("isClientVCard");
#define ROW(name, iq, clientVCard) \
QTest::newRow(QT_STRINGIFY(name)) << iq << clientVCard
QXmppVCardIq iq;
iq.setType(QXmppIq::Result);
iq.setTo("stpeter@jabber.org/roundabout");
iq.setFullName("Jeremie Miller");
auto iqFromBare = iq;
iqFromBare.setFrom("stpeter@jabber.org");
auto iqFromFull = iq;
iqFromFull.setFrom("stpeter@jabber.org/roundabout");
ROW(client-vcard-from-empty, iq, true);
ROW(client-vcard-from-bare, iqFromBare, true);
ROW(client-vcard-from-full, iqFromFull, false);
#undef ROW
}
void tst_QXmppVCardManager::testHandleStanza()
{
QFETCH(QXmppVCardIq, expectedIq);
QFETCH(bool, isClientVCard);
// initialize new manager to clear internal values
QXmppVCardManager *manager = new QXmppVCardManager();
m_client.addExtension(manager);
// sets own jid internally
m_client.connectToServer("stpeter@jabber.org", {});
m_client.disconnectFromServer();
bool vCardReceived = false;
bool clientVCardReceived = false;
QObject context;
connect(manager, &QXmppVCardManager::vCardReceived, &context, [&](QXmppVCardIq iq) {
vCardReceived = true;
QCOMPARE(iq, expectedIq);
});
connect(manager, &QXmppVCardManager::clientVCardReceived, &context, [&]() {
clientVCardReceived = true;
QCOMPARE(manager->clientVCard(), expectedIq);
});
bool accepted = manager->handleStanza(writePacketToDom(expectedIq));
QVERIFY(accepted);
QVERIFY(vCardReceived);
QCOMPARE(clientVCardReceived, isClientVCard);
// clean up (client deletes manager)
m_client.removeExtension(manager);
}
void tst_QXmppVCardManager::testSetClientVCard()
{
SKIP_IF_INTEGRATION_TESTS_DISABLED();
auto client = std::make_unique<QXmppClient>();
auto *vCardManager = client->findExtension<QXmppVCardManager>();
auto config = IntegrationTests::clientConfiguration();
QSignalSpy connectSpy(client.get(), &QXmppClient::connected);
QSignalSpy disconnectSpy(client.get(), &QXmppClient::disconnected);
QSignalSpy vCardSpy(vCardManager, &QXmppVCardManager::clientVCardReceived);
// connect to server
client->connectToServer(config);
QVERIFY2(connectSpy.wait(), "Could not connect to server!");
// request own vcard
vCardManager->requestClientVCard();
QVERIFY(vCardSpy.wait());
// check our vcard has the correct address
QCOMPARE(vCardManager->clientVCard().from(), client->configuration().jidBare());
// set a new vcard
QXmppVCardIq newVCard;
newVCard.setFirstName(QStringLiteral("Bob"));
newVCard.setBirthday(QDate(1, 2, 2000));
newVCard.setEmail(QStringLiteral("bob@qxmpp.org"));
vCardManager->setClientVCard(newVCard);
// there's currently no signal to see whether the change was successful...
QCoreApplication::processEvents();
// reconnect
client->disconnectFromServer();
QVERIFY(disconnectSpy.wait());
client->connectToServer(config);
QVERIFY2(connectSpy.wait(), "Could not connect to server!");
// request own vcard
vCardManager->requestClientVCard();
QVERIFY(vCardSpy.wait());
// check our vcard has been changed successfully
QCOMPARE(vCardManager->clientVCard().from(), client->configuration().jidBare());
QCOMPARE(vCardManager->clientVCard().firstName(), QStringLiteral("Bob"));
QCOMPARE(vCardManager->clientVCard().birthday(), QDate(01, 02, 2000));
QCOMPARE(vCardManager->clientVCard().email(), QStringLiteral("bob@qxmpp.org"));
// reset the vcard for future tests
vCardManager->setClientVCard(QXmppVCardIq());
// disconnect
client->disconnectFromServer();
QVERIFY(disconnectSpy.wait());
}
QTEST_MAIN(tst_QXmppVCardManager)
#include "tst_qxmppvcardmanager.moc"
